This dressing is really light and fresh and you can use it on a day-to-day basis without getting sick of it. It can be great on a cucumbers and tomatoes salad as well as on a green leafy salad. The maple syrup highlights the multiple flavors, but it also adds a bit of sugar in a way that is healthy for you (hyperlien interne vers l’article Is maple syrup healthy?).

Ingredients

-1 cup of olive oil

-1/2 cup of white balsamic vinegar

-1 tablespoon of yellow mustard

-1 tablespoon of pure maple syrup

-1 teaspoon of dry herbs (coriander or thyme)

-1/2 teaspoon of garlic powder

-Salt and pepper

Instructions

1. In a bowl, whisk all the ingredients together, then keep in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
